Sharp LCD TV
Sharp LC-20B4U-S 20" LCD Television
Model: Sharp LC-20B4U-S LCD TV
MSRP: $2,199
Lowest Online Price: $979See all Online Prices
The AQUOS™ LC-20B4U-S with built-in cable TV tuner is only 3" deep with an elegant design and features 480p (EDTV) compatibility for progressive DVD players. And with Sharp's proprietary Advanced Super View LCD panel, it has a higher contrast ratio and wider viewing angles than conventional LCD TVs, making it truly "TV where you want it," for any room in the house!
Sharp LCD Specifications
Screen Size 20" diagonal Screen Aspect 4:3 Contrast Ratio 500:1 Brightness 430cd/m2 Pixel Pitch [not published] hSync [not published] vSync [not published] Color System NTSC, PAL, SECAM Data Signals (N/A) TV Scan Lines up to 525p
Input Terminals
Composite Video 2 (RCA) S-Video 2 (4-pin mini DIN) Component Video 1 (RCA x 3) Stereo Audio In 3 (RCA L/R)

Dimensions and General Specs.
Power Supply 100-120V @ 50-60Hz Power Consumption [not published] Dimensions 24 51/64" x 15 1/32" x 3" Weight 16.10 lbs. FCC Class FCC Class B, Home Use

Sharp LC-20B4U-S LCD TV
The Sharp AQUOS™ LCD TV models have a compact, space-saving, energy-efficient design and Sharp's Advanced Super View (ASV) LCD technology. The ASV Low-Reflection Black TFT LCD panel delivers wide viewing angles and high contrast, and works in combination with a high-quality Picture Processing Engine to yield crisp images and rich, saturated colors.
![]()
Besides setting the standards for both performance and style in Liquid Crystal Televisions, the AQUOS line offers more distinct advantages: They’re incredibly thin. They’re exceptionally light. They’re astonishingly bright. Amazingly long-lasting. And there’s no “burn-in,” the condition where a still image can become a permanent part of the panel after an extended period of time. The advantages continue. Exceptional brightness means vivid pictures—even when the AQUOS is placed in brightly lit rooms or near windows. Similarly, a high contrast ratio allows superb detail and color purity even during very dark or very bright scenes. And an outstanding 60,000 hour lamp life and low power consumption translate into exceptional efficiency.
An extremely wide viewing angle—170° x 170°—lets you enjoy your AQUOS from anywhere in the room. Our proprietary ASV (Advanced Super View) high-performance LCD panel continues to be the most impressive in the industry, thanks in part to our exclusive Black TFT low-reflection coating which significantly reduces glare even under harsh lighting conditions.
AQUOS LCDs come equipped with a wide range of input/output jacks, including a D2 video input jack that supports progressive-scan (525p) video signal sources such as DVDs and digital BS (broadcast satellite) broadcasts, and a monitor output jack for connecting with audio equipment, making these units a key part of any A/V system.
The sleek, elegant AQUOS design is by world-class industrial designer Toshiyuki Kita, and takes full advantage of the slim profile and small footprint of the LCD TV. A built-in stand and Carrying Handle adds to convenience. Combined with the optional SmartLink wireless digital A/V transmission system, these units deliver “portable home viewing” that allows users to enjoy DVDs and TV broadcasts anywhere in the house, even in rooms without an antenna jack.
